From Webstaurantstore.com, here are 10 ways beer makes you healthier:

  • 1

    Kidney Stone Prevention

    Beer contains high levels of potassium, and it acts as a diuretic. which are both great for kidney health and function.

  • 2

    Heart Health

    Beer can actually raise levels of HDL, which is the good cholesterol your body needs. Having higher levels of HDL lowers your risk of heart attack and hypertension.

  • 3

    B as in Beer

    Your favorite cold brew contains essential B vitamins, especially vitamin B6, which is important for hormone regulation and healthy brain function.

  • 4

    Better Brain Function

    Believe it or not, drinking beer can actually aid your overall cognitive health. Xanthohumol is a flavonoid that contributes to this.

  • 5

    Run Recovery

    The polyphenols that are found in beer hops can reduce inflammation in the muscles and joints. A study at the University of Granada in Spain found that drinking a pint of beer post workout was actually more hydrating than the same amount of water.

  • 6

    Good for Your Gut

    Beer contains soluble fiber from malt, which is essential to the brewing process and aids in overall GI health. It also stimulates the production of certain necessary stomach enzymes.

  • 7

    Strong Brews for Strong Bones

    Beer contains silicone, which functions to keep bones strong, warding off osteoporosis and lowering your risk of bone fractures.

  • 8

    Staves off Type 2 Diabetes

    Chemicals called isohumulones , which contribute to the bitter taste in beer, can act to keep blood sugars at a healthy level, reducing your risk of developing type-2 diabetes.

  • 9

    Common Cold Killer

    The antioxidants found in goji berries and acai are also floating around in your pint glass. These helpful chemicals are especially prevalent in fruit beers and work to keep the common cold at bay.

  • 10

    Stress Reliever

    Finally, there's nothing quite like the stress relief that comes from indulging in your favorite brew. Drinking beer is not only delicious, but can also lower your blood pressure and help you sleep better.
